Creative Wedding Signature Board Ideas
Signature boards provide a unique way for guests to leave their mark, capturing memories from your special day. Here are some creative ideas to inspire your wedding signature board choices.
Personalized Wooden Boards
Personalized wooden boards serve as a rustic yet elegant option for wedding signature boards. You can choose a wood type that matches your venue’s theme. Consider customizing the board with your names and wedding date engraved. Guests can sign with permanent markers, creating a timeless keepsake. Enhance the design with decorations like flowers or your wedding colors, making it visually appealing.
Canvas Signature Boards
Canvas signature boards offer a modern touch for your wedding decor. Pick a canvas featuring a beautiful design or your engagement photo as a backdrop. Guests can sign the canvas with colorful fabric markers, adding a splash of color to their messages. After the wedding, you can display the signed canvas in your home as a piece of art. To make it memorable, add an instruction sign encouraging guests to write personal messages or draw small doodles.
Unique Themes for Signature Boards
Choosing a signature board theme adds personality to your wedding. Unique designs enhance decor and provide a memorable experience for your guests. Below are theme ideas that stand out.
Rustic Chic Designs
Rustic chic designs incorporate natural elements that create a warm, inviting atmosphere. Consider using:
- Wooden Slabs: Use cut logs or reclaimed wood as the signature board. Guests can sign directly on the surface, giving a homey touch.
- Hanging Frames: Display a string of wooden frames with twine. Guests leave their signatures and well-wishes on small cards attached to each frame.
- Mason Jars: Place mason jars filled with vibrant colored pens. Attach a burlap or lace label for a rustic feel, encouraging guests to leave messages.
Modern Minimalist Styles
Modern minimalist styles focus on simplicity and elegance. For a contemporary vibe, think about:
- Acrylic Boards: Use a clear acrylic board that blends into any decor. Guests can write with metallic or colorful markers to create a stunning contrast.
- Geometric Shapes: Opt for signature boards in geometric shapes. Designs like hexagons or triangles not only stand out but also complement modern wedding aesthetics.
- Monochromatic Palettes: Keep it sleek with black and white themes. Use a white board with black or gray markers for a classy, understated look.
These unique themes offer flexibility and creativity, ensuring your signature board is a perfect fit for your wedding style.
Incorporating Guest Interaction
Incorporating guest interaction into your wedding signature board adds a fun and memorable element. Guests can leave personal messages, creative doodles, or thoughtful advice, turning the board into a cherished keepsake.
Fun and Engaging Prompts
Utilize fun prompts to inspire guests and spark creativity. Examples include:
- “Share a piece of advice”: Encourage guests to provide words of wisdom for your journey ahead.
- “Draw your best memory of us”: Guests can illustrate memorable moments they’ve shared with you.
- “Add a wish for the future”: Invite loved ones to express their hopes for your marriage.
Position these prompts clearly on the board. This guidance encourages participation and ensures guests feel comfortable expressing themselves.
Interactive Photo Boards
Interactive photo boards provide another layer of engagement. Set up a designated area with a backdrop and props. Guests can take photos and sign the board alongside their pictures.
Options for your photo board include:
- Polaroid Photos: Guests can snap instant photos, write messages, and attach them directly to the board.
- Digital Guestbook Stations: Use tablets for guests to upload pictures and sign messages digitally, which can later be printed as a book.
Incorporating these elements enhances interaction and creates a dynamic way for guests to participate in your special day.
Selecting the Right Materials
Choosing the right materials for your wedding signature board affects both its aesthetics and functionality. Consider factors like budget, style, and the desired guest interaction when making your selections.
Budget-Friendly Options
- Plywood Boards: Use smooth plywood as a canvas. It’s cost-effective and can be painted or stained to match your wedding colors.
- Canvas: Purchase a blank canvas as a signature board. It’s affordable and allows for easy writing with markers.
- Paper Rolls: Roll out butcher paper or craft paper. Guests can sign directly on the paper, creating a unique art piece that can be framed later.
- Cork Boards: Utilize cork boards for a pinning option. Guests can attach messages or photos with decorative pins.
- Mason Jars with Notes: Set up mason jars for guests to drop in handwritten notes. This option adds a personal touch while staying within budget.
- Acrylic Boards: Opt for clear acrylic boards. They offer a modern and sleek look, creating an elegant focal point for your wedding.
- Framed Mirrors: Choose a vintage or modern mirror as a signature board. Guests can use dry-erase markers, leaving messages that reflect the ambiance.
- Custom Wood Signs: Order personalized wooden signs with etched or painted designs. These pieces add sophistication and enhance your decor.
- Metal Prints: Invest in metal prints for a polished aesthetic. The glossy finish provides a sleek backdrop for signatures.
- Fabric Panels: Consider fabric-covered boards for a plush feel. Use rich colors and textures that align with your wedding theme.
